Stopping The Engine

Normal Shutdown

1. Move throttle lever quickly from the FULL OPEN to IDLE

position (Figure 13 ) and run the engine for three minutes at
low speed.

2. The MTR40F tamping rammer is designed to run between

3,800~4,100 rpms. At optimum rpm the foot hits at the rate of
650~695 impacts per minute. Increasing throttle speed past
factory set rpm does not increase impacts and may damage
unit. The MTR40F is designed to advance while tamping. For
faster advance, pull back slightly on the handle so that rear
of foot contacts soil first.

Operation

1. To start the rammer tamping action, move the throttle lever

(Figure 12)

quickly

from IDLE (close) to the FULL OPEN

position. DO NOT move the throttle lever slowly as this may
cause damage to the clutch or spring.

Emergency Showdown

1. Move the throttle lever quickly to the

IDLE

position, and turn

the engine ON/OFF switch to the

OFF

position. Turn the fuel

valve lever to the

CLOSED

position.

OPERATION

Make sure that the throttle lever is moved to the FULL OPEN
position. Operating the rammer at less than full speeds can
result in damage to the clutch springs or foot.
